How does a roller press machine form granules from chicken manure, crop straw, humic acid, and sewage sludge?
The feed hopper sends the blended powder between two counter-rotating rollers, and the rollers press the material into a compact sheet. A crushing unit then breaks the sheet into granules, and a screen separates the target size from fine powder. Your operators can adjust roller pressure and feed speed for different material moisture levels. This process works without added water, so the roller press machine system keeps the production flow short and reduces drying cost.
Which roller size and power fit a 1-3 t/h dry granulation plant?
Smaller roller models suit a plant that produces about 1 to 1.5 tons per hour, while larger rollers support 1.5 to 3 tons per hour. Your team can compare roller diameter, motor power, and finished granule size before choosing a model. A machine with a 150 mm or 186 mm roller width often works well for small NPK and organic fertilizer batches. The roller press machine line can produce granules from 3 mm to 15 mm depending on the mold you select.
How does the dry roller process support a fertilizer manufacturing system?
The dry granulation route removes the dryer and cooler, so your plant uses less energy and needs less space. You can connect a horizontal mixer, a chain crusher, the roller granulator, a screening machine, and a packaging scale into one flow. The screen returns fine powder to the feed, which improves material use. This arrangement supports continuous fertilizer extrusion technology for both compound and organic fertilizer.
